The corporate program “Promoting Equal Pay – Advising, Supporting, Strengthening Businesses” in Germany

28 Sep 2022

With the corporate program “Promoting Equal Pay – Advising, Supporting, Strengthening Businesses”, the Federal Ministry for Family Affairs, Senior Citizens, Women and Youth supports companies in developing strategies to strengthen their “fair pay goals”.

Since 2017, the Transparency in Wage Structures Act has been helping companies and employees in Germany to better achieve equal pay for equal or equivalent work in practice in accordance with the equal pay requirement. Equal opportunities and fair pay both for women and men boost the competitiveness of companies and contribute to derive far better benefits of the potential of employees.

The Transparency in Wage Structures Act addresses one substantial cause of the gender pay gap: lack of transparency in corporate pay structures and wage determination processes. Transparency helps to eliminate unjustified differences in pay and provides a view to the adjustments to more equal opportunities for women and men in companies and enterprises.

The program shows companies the value of equality between women and men and how they can implement transparency in pay structures. An equality-oriented and modern work culture strengthens companies and the economy, because sustainable companies rely on transparent, fair and equitable compensation.
